This is a 101 IT cyber security short course designed to teach you about IT security issues, looking at the types of attacks that are happening now, how they work and how to protect yourself and your organisation against them. Course overview. How to apply. This course will provide students with an understanding of what cyber crime is, including aspects of capabilities, jurisdiction, sovereignty, state responsibility, various cyber-attack and defence tools, consequences, occupation and neutrality.

Co-author of the study, Professor Federico Varese from Sciences Po in France, said the World Cybercrime Index is the first step in a broader aim to understand the local dimensions of cybercrime production across the world.
Apr 11, 2024 The Index, released today, shows that a relatively small number of countries house the greatest cybercriminal threat. Russia tops the list, followed by Ukraine, China, the USA, Nigeria, and Romania. Australia comes in at number 34.
